Productdescription
The Fischer DE28 Differential Pressure Transmitter is a robust, maintenance-free measuring instrument designed for overpressure, partial vacuum, and differential pressure monitoring of liquid and gaseous media. Featuring measuring ranges from 0-0.4 to 0-6 bar with a nominal pressure rating of 16 bar, this versatile transmitter excels in industrial and sanitary applications including heating system flow monitoring, filter supervision, and compressor oversight. Built around a rugged diaphragm movement system, the DE28 utilizes an inductive displacement transducer that converts mechanical motion into precise electrical output signals (0/4-20 mA or 0-10 V DC) with exceptional linearity (≤2% FS) and minimal hysteresis (≤1% FS). The transmitter operates reliably in ambient temperatures from 0 to +70°C and provides comprehensive overpressure protection up to nominal pressure on both sides. Constructed with a polycarbonate case and brass pressure chamber, the DE28 offers flexible connection options including G 1/8 female threads and cutting ring connections for 6mm or 8mm tubes.
